Australia-Weather-Surf
Large waves crash into cliffs at Bronte Beach near Sydney on June 24, 2013. Expected extreme weather did not arrive in Sydney but a large trough sitting off the coast has generated large damaging surf and king tides. AFP PHOTO / Greg WOOD / AFP PHOTO / GREG WOOD
